"Eased 4 edges" in decking wood refers to the process of smoothing or beveling the edges of the boards on all four sides. This treatment reduces sharp corners, making the boards safer to handle and install, while also enhancing their appearance by giving them a more finished look. Eased edges can help prevent splintering and provide a more comfortable surface for walking.

Sometimes after a surgical procedure, the digestive system needs to be eased back into eating normal foods. Advance as tolerated means to progress to more difficult foods as long as the patient is not having adverse reactions.
